    • The 2004 survey was funded by a grant from the Ford Foundation and included probability samples of the adult population 16 to 64 years old. The present article considers only the 431 males under 40 in the sample. The 2005 survey was funded by grants from the Charles Stewart Mott Foundation and the Glaser Progress Foundation and included 16 to 29 year olds. The manuscript considers the 991 male respondents from that sample

    • The authors ran a series of bivariate and multivariate analyses to see if support for a greater political role for Islam correlates with other variables that might be associated with Islamic extremists: anti-American and anti-Russian sentiment, support for the withdrawal of federal forces from Chechnya, and various anti-Western attitudes. In no case was a clear-cut relationship found. Thus, the authors do not think the data provide much evidence of surging support for radical Islam in these republics
